Fundamentally, a sterile environment is a specially designed space constructed to maintain extremely low concentrations of dust and microorganisms. These rooms are critical for sectors like electronics fabrication, pharmaceutical production, life science work, and precision medical instruments fabrication. Knowing the fundamentals of controlled environment design, classification (often measured on ISO guidelines), and maintenance is key for individuals involved in these procedures.

Who Demand a Sterile Area? Sectors and Uses

Beyond simply electronics manufacturing, a surprising range of sectors depend on cleanroom conditions. Medical development and manufacturing are critical areas, maintaining the integrity of medications and organic substances. Aerospace engineering gains from controlled environment processes to build complex elements. Culinary preparation, especially for gourmet goods, demands strict hygiene standards. Alternative uses cover modern clinical apparatus manufacturing, light arrangement design, and even some movie production techniques.
